ワークシート内のスレッドコメントを抽出する

導入

デジタル時代では、ドキュメントの管理と共同作業はワークフローに不可欠です。Excel スプレッドシートには、多くの場合、データや洞察が豊富に含まれており、追加のコンテキストや提案を提供するコメントが含まれています。Aspose.Cells for .NET を使用すると、スレッド化されたコメントの抽出と処理がシームレスになります。このチュートリアルでは、プログラミング経験に関係なく、Excel ワークシートからスレッド化されたコメントを効率的に取得する手順を説明します。

前提条件

コーディングを始める前に、以下のものを用意しておいてください。

  1. C# の基礎知識: コード例は C# で記述されるため、C# と .NET Framework の知識が必須です。
  2. Visual Studio: C# コードを実行するには、マシンに Visual Studio をインストールします。
  3. Aspose.Cells for .NET: Aspose.Cellsライブラリを以下のサイトからダウンロードしてインストールします。Aspose ウェブサイト.
  4. サンプルExcelファイル: サンプルExcelファイル(例:ThreadedCommentsSample.xlsx) を、テスト用のスレッド化されたコメントを含むディレクトリに保存します。

必要なパッケージのインポート

Aspose.Cells の強力な機能を活用するには、C# プロジェクトに必要な名前空間を含める必要があります。C# ファイルの先頭に次の宣言を追加します。

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;

ステップ1: ソースディレクトリを設定する

まず、Excel ファイルが保存されているディレクトリを指定します。パスがシステム上のファイルの場所と一致していることを確認します。

//ソースディレクトリ
string sourceDir = "Your Document Directory";

交換する"Your Document Directory\" Excel ファイルへの実際のパスを入力します。

ステップ2: ワークブックオブジェクトを作成する

次に、Workbook Excel ファイルを読み込んで操作するためのオブジェクト。

//ワークブックを読み込む
Workbook workbook = new Workbook(sourceDir + "ThreadedCommentsSample.xlsx");

ステップ3: ワークシートにアクセスする

ワークブックを読み込んだ後、スレッド化されたコメントを含む特定のワークシートにアクセスします。この例では、最初のワークシートにアクセスします。

//最初のワークシートにアクセスする
Worksheet worksheet = workbook.Worksheets[0];

ステップ4: スレッド化されたコメントを取得する

ここで、特定のセルからスレッド化されたコメントを取得します。この例では、セル「A1」をターゲットにします。

//スレッドコメントを取得する
ThreadedCommentCollection threadedComments = worksheet.Comments.GetThreadedComments("A1");

ステップ5: コメントを繰り返す

スレッド化されたコメントのコレクションを入手したら、各コメントをループして、コメントのテキストや作成者の名前などの関連情報を抽出します。

//各スレッドコメントをループする
foreach (ThreadedComment comment in threadedComments)
{
    Console.WriteLine("Comment: " + comment.Notes);
    Console.WriteLine("Author: " + comment.Author.Name);
}

ステップ6: 実行が成功したことを確認する

最後に、プログラムが正常に実行されたことを確認しましょう。

Console.WriteLine("ReadThreadedComments executed successfully.");

結論

おめでとうございます! Aspose.Cells for .NET を使用して、Excel ワークシートからスレッド化されたコメントを正常に抽出できました。わずか数行のコードで、Excel ドキュメントから貴重な情報にアクセスし、チーム内のコミュニケーションとコラボレーションを強化できます。

よくある質問

Aspose.Cells とは何ですか?

Aspose.Cells は、開発者が .NET アプリケーションで Excel ドキュメントを作成、操作、変換できるようにする強力なライブラリです。

Aspose.Cells をダウンロードするにはどうすればいいですか?

Aspose.Cellsは以下からダウンロードできます。リリースページはこちら.

無料トライアルはありますか?

はい!Aspose.Cellsは無料トライアルを提供しています。ここ.

Aspose.Cells のサポートを受けることはできますか?

もちろんです!Aspose サポート フォーラム.

Aspose.Cells はどこで購入できますか?

Aspose.Cellsを購入する場合は、ここ.